TotallynotJessica to Yuri memesEnglish · 1 month agoHomosexualsimagemessage-square7fedilinkarrow-up1111file-text
arrow-up1111imageHomosexualsTotallynotJessica to Yuri memesEnglish · 1 month agomessage-square7fedilinkfile-text
I LOVE GREEN TEA BITCH EAHHHH